Monetization is another reason why people evaluate the most powerful blogging tools. Whether you're looking to monetize your posts through banner ads or sell digital products, it's important that the platform supports flexible revenue models. Substack transformed this area by enabling paid newsletters directly through subscriptions. This paywall approach is ideal for niche creators who deliver quality content and want to build reader relationships. Its simple interface and straightforward payout model make it a breakthrough for solo publishers alike.
On the other hand, platforms like Blogspot, despite being longstanding, still hold relevance. Backed by Google, Blogger offers simple integration with AdSense, making it quick to start earning. Although not as trendy than some of the newer platforms, Blogger remains functional due to its reliability, search engine friendliness, and free-to-use nature. For users seeking a no-fuss way to start a blog, Blogger remains one of the most beginner-friendly tools in the lineup of top blogging websites.
